Hot Water Demographics - Sandford
Based on the Australian Bureau of Statistics 2021 Census (ABS), Sandford has around 502 private dwellings, home to approximately 931 people. With an average household size of 2.4 people, and around 50 litres of hot water used per person each day in Australia, Sandford households use approximately 120 litres of hot water daily, equating to a massive 0.1 million litres of hot water used across the suburb every single day.
Other census insights reinforce Sandford's suitability for energy-saving improvements like energy-efficient or solar-powered hot water. The Sandford community is home to 75 couple families with children and 12 one-parent families, meaning a large proportion of households face substantial hot water demand. With 104 homes owned with a mortgage and 222 owned outright, many residents also have the homeownership and growing equity that make switching to efficient hot water systems a practical way to lower expenses.
Sandford is converting hot water demand to efficient systems faster than many peers, with 6.6% of dwellings already upgraded.

Average bill savings from an upgrade in a town like Sandford typically look like this:
• Replacing an old electric hot water system with a quality heat pump: save around $350–$700 a year. • Swapping gas hot water for a heat pump hot water system: save roughly $250–$500 a year. • Moving from gas to a solar hot water system: save about $200–$450 a year. • Upgrading an old electric unit to a modern electric hot water system timed to run on solar: save around $200–$400 a year.

Hot Water Rebates, Tariffs & Savings
For Sandford households looking to replace old gas or electric units, there is strong support from both Federal and Victorian programs. The Australian Government’s Small‑scale Technology Certificates (STCs) apply to eligible heat pump and solar hot water systems, effectively cutting the solar hot water price / cost or heat pump hot water price / cost at the point of sale. On top of that, Victorian schemes can offer a heat pump hot water rebate or solar hot water rebate, and in some cases an electric hot water system rebate when you are moving towards an all‑electric home. For many Sandford homeowners, these hot water rebate vic incentives can trim the upfront cost by a substantial percentage and shorten payback to just a few years, especially if you run your system on a solar‑friendly tariff, use timers, or divert excess rooftop solar into your hot water.
